306 of 410 menu

Funkcija fputcsv

Funkcija fputcsv formatira prosleđeni niz u string CSV formata i upisuje ga u naznačeni fajl. Prvi parametar funkcija prihvata pokazivač na fajl, drugi - niz podataka za upis. Trećim parametrom se može naznačiti razdvajač polja (podrazumevano zarez), četvrtim - ograničivač stringova (podrazumevano dvostruki navodnici).

Sintaksa

fputcsv( resource $handle, array $fields, string $delimiter = ",", string $enclosure = '"', string $escape_char = "\" );

Primer

Zapišimo niz u CSV fajl:

<?php $file = fopen('data.csv', 'w'); $data = ['a', 'b', 'c', 'd', 'e']; fputcsv($file, $data); fclose($file); ?>

Sadržaj fajla data.csv:

"a","b","c","d","e"

Primer

Zapišimo nekoliko redova u CSV fajl sa korišćenjem tačke sa zarezom kao razdvajačem:

<?php $file = fopen('data.csv', 'w'); $data1 = [1, 2, 3, 4, 5]; $data2 = ['x', 'y', 'z']; fputcsv($file, $data1, ';'); fputcsv($file, $data2, ';'); fclose($file); ?>

Sadržaj fajla data.csv:

"1";"2";"3";"4";"5" "x";"y";"z"

Primer

Zapišimo niz sa podacima koji sadrže zareze:

<?php $file = fopen('data.csv', 'w'); $data = ['John, Doe', 'johndoe@example.com', 'New York']; fputcsv($file, $data); fclose($file); ?>

Sadržaj fajla data.csv:

"John, Doe","johndoe@example.com","New York"

Pogledajte takođe

  • funkciju fgetcsv,
    koja čita podatke iz CSV-a
  • funkciju fwrite,
    koja upisuje u fajl
  • funkciju fopen,
    koja otvara fajl
Srpski
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Koristimo kolačiće za rad sajta, analitiku i personalizaciju. Obrada podataka se vrši u skladu sa Politikom privatnosti.
prihvati sve podesi odbij